Abstract

The invention discloses a kind of effectively mute reciprocating pumps, belong to the technical field of reciprocating pump, it includes pedestal and the reciprocating pump ontology that is fixedly connected on pedestal, the blimp that can surround reciprocating pump setting is connected on pedestal, blimp inner sidewall array is provided with multiple mute units that can absorb sound wave, box body is fixedly connected at the top of blimp, silencing system is provided in box body, silencing system includes the inside sound wave monitoring module for receiving blimp interior noise, noise is converted into the acoustic wave analysis module of acoustic pressure waveform, sound wave for generating the antinoise computing module of antinoise signal and for exporting from antinoise signal to blimp issues module, the present invention has the noise that reciprocating pump sending can be greatly reduced, realize the effect that silence processing is carried out to reciprocating pump.

Background technique
Reciprocating pump includes piston pump, metering pump and diaphragm pump at present, is generally called reciprocating pump.It is one kind of positive-dispacement pump, is answered With than wide.Reciprocating pump is to provide the conveyer of energy to liquid directly in the form of pressure energy by the reciprocating motion of piston Tool.By driving method, reciprocating pump is divided into power pump (motor drive) and direct acting pump (steam, gas or liquid driven) two is big Class.Reciprocating pump is in use since self structure is complicated and water flow movement can generate water hammer effect, so ratio can be issued Biggish noise can all use certain denoising structure in actual application.
The prior art can refer to the Chinese invention patent that Authorization Notice No. is CN103967737B, and it discloses a kind of reciprocal Pump, it is characterised in that: reciprocating pump is horizontal reciprocating pump, and the top of the horizontal reciprocating pump is arranged prime mover, prime mover with it is horizontal Reciprocating pump is connected by vertical type transmission mechanism.Compared with the prior art, the advantages of the present invention are as follows: reciprocating pump uses horizontal pump weight The heart is low, not the tilting moment of vertical reciprocation pump, and being driven horizontal reciprocating pump using vertical belt has occupied area small, vibration Small, belt life is long, and noise of motor is low, operates more stable and reliable.
Prior art among the above has the following deficiencies: that the noise reasons generated due to reciprocating pump are more complicated, past For multiple pump even across above-mentioned technical proposal noise reduction, the noise of generation can still be maintained at a higher situation, though using every Sound cover covers fuselage, due to that can not cover reciprocating pump, or meeting gap completely, still has no small influence, In to ambient enviroment Under the operating condition of portion requirements quiet environment, reciprocating pump needs to carry out silence processing.

Specific embodiment
Embodiment: a kind of effectively mute reciprocating pump as depicted in figs. 1 and 2, including pedestal 2 and is fixedly connected on pedestal 2 On reciprocating pump ontology 1.Pedestal 2 is made of the flexible material such as vulcanie, 65Mn.Being connected on pedestal 2 can wrap The blimp 3 of reciprocating pump setting is enclosed, the clamping groove 21 of cooperation blimp 3 is offered on pedestal 2, pedestal 2 is close to clamping groove 21 The place of setting is fixedly connected with buffer layer 22, and buffer layer 22 is made of the flexible material such as TPEE, TPR, and blimp 3 can be clamped In in buffer layer 22.The noise that blimp 3 is used to that reciprocating pump ontology 1 to be stopped to issue, and blimp 3 can take from pedestal 2 Under, facilitate user maintenance reciprocating pump.
As shown in Fig. 2, blimp 3 offers inclined-plane 33 at 22 position of buffer layer, inclined-plane 33 from 3 bottom of blimp to The setting of 3 outer incline of blimp.Inclined-plane 33 can make blimp 3 be easier that buffer layer 22 occurs when being connected in clamping groove 21 Deformation, it is easier to be inserted into clamping groove 21, while can also reinforce the stability of 3 relative position of blimp.
As shown in Figure 3 and Figure 4,3 inner sidewall array of blimp is provided with multiple mute units 31, and mute unit 31 includes It several lateral fins 311 for being fixedly connected on 3 inner sidewall of blimp and is fixedly connected on several vertical on 3 inner sidewall of blimp To fin 312.Lateral fin 311 is identical as longitudinal shape of fin 312, the length of one side of the lateral fin 311 close to mute cover While being transversely to the machine direction fin 312 close to the long side of the one side of mute cover.Lateral fin 311 and longitudinal fin 312 are to 2 side of pedestal To being obliquely installed.Lateral fin 311 effectively absorbs sound with longitudinal mutual cooperation of fin 312, while also can be right Blimp 3 plays certain booster action, reduces the broken possibility of blimp 3.
As shown in figure 5, cavity 23 is offered inside pedestal 2, filled with non-newtonian fluids such as rubber solutions in cavity 23 231.Non-newtonian fluid 231 can fully absorb reciprocating pump softer by subtleer vibration or not vibrated dynamic formula The pressure that ontology 1 generates absorbs low amplitude vibrations.And non-newtonian fluid 231 can become harder, energy when being shaken Enough prevent pedestal 2 from generating bigger vibration.
Fig. 2 and Fig. 3 are reviewed, box body 32 is fixedly connected at the top of blimp 3, silencing system 4 is provided in box body 32.Box body 32 bottoms are fixedly connected with multiple loudspeakers 321, and 321 array of loudspeaker is set in box body 32 and is located inside mute cover. Sound detection equipment 451 is fixedly connected at the top of box body 32.
As shown in Figure 6 and Figure 7, silencing system 4 includes internal sound wave monitoring module 41, acoustic wave analysis module 42, sound wave point It analyses module 42, sound wave sending module 44, external noise monitoring modular 45, noise judgment module 46, wireless transport module 47 and determines Position module 48.
As shown in fig. 6, noise and output inside internal 41 real-time reception blimp 3 of sound wave monitoring module.Acoustic wave analysis Module 42 receives noise and analyzes the acoustic pressure waveform of noise, and acoustic wave analysis module 42 exports acoustic pressure waveform.Antinoise computing module 43 receive acoustic pressure waveform and the 180 ° of phases that are staggered, and generate antinoise signal, and antinoise computing module 43 exports antinoise signal.Sound Wave issues module 44 and receives antinoise signal and export antinoise signal by loudspeaker 321.Silencing system 4 can real-time monitoring every Noise inside sound cover 3 simultaneously issues anti-noise signal, and antinoise signal is interfered and supported with the noise inside blimp 3 Disappear, the noise of the generation of reciprocating pump ontology 1 is greatly reduced.
As shown in fig. 7, external noise monitoring modular 45 connects sound detection equipment 451, sound detection equipment 451 is examined in real time Survey blimp 3 outside noise decibel and export.Noise judgment module 46 receives noise decibel and is simultaneously compared with preset value, when making an uproar When cent shellfish is greater than preset value, the output of noise judgment module 46 has the alarm signal of noise decibel.In wireless transport module 47 It is stored with device numbering, wireless transport module 47 receives alarm signal and alarm signal is sent to user together with device numbering Mobile device, the mobile device of user can be mobile phone, tablet computer, laptop computer etc., and wireless transport module 47 can lead to It crosses the modes such as short message, QQ message, wechat message and sends information to mobile device.Silencing system 4 can monitor outside reciprocating pump Noise decibel, to judge whether silencing system 4 fails or reciprocating pump failure is so that noise is excessive, in judgement failure Silencing system 4 can transmit information to remind user in the mobile device of user afterwards, overhaul in time convenient for user.
As shown in fig. 7, locating module 48 detects and records current device location and to 47 transmission location of wireless transport module Information, wireless transport module 47 issue location information when sending alarm signal together with alarm signal.Location information can User is helped quickly to find the reciprocating pump of failure.
Usage mode: the noise inside the meeting real-time monitoring blimp 3 of silencing system 4 exports and noise after analysis The anti-noise signal of antiphase carrys out offset noise.Since the noise that reciprocating pump generates is more complicated, so needing acoustic insulating unit Preliminary absorption is carried out to noise, while can also absorb the sound not being canceled out, and the work for mitigating silencing system 4 is strong Degree improves the noise treatment intensity of silencing system 4.Even if the noise source that reciprocating pump of the invention generates is more complicated, also can be right Reciprocating pump ontology 1 carries out silence processing, adapts to the operating condition more demanding to quiet environment.
